“I’m afraid we’ll lose a team that has its own style.” More – about the possible appointment of Artiga to Rubin
Former Spartak Moscow football player Eduard More said on Match TV that he does not understand why Rubin would exchange Rashid Rakhimov for Spaniard Frank Artiga.
On January 10, Artiga left his post as head coach of the Angolan club Petro Athletica. At the end of December, agent Dmitry Selyuk, representing the interests of the Spaniard, told Match TV that the specialist was in negotiations with Rubin.
“I don’t understand these conversations.” Rubin is in seventh place… The possible departure of Rakhimov is strange for me. What more can you expect for Kazan residents? To be higher than seventh place, we need to improve more, but this did not happen. They must stick to Rakhimov and agree to all conditions.
In Khimki, Artiga’s football was reduced to primitiveness – throws at Zabolotny, and he simply threw the ball away. What new did Artiga give to the team? Nothing. What can he give to Rubin? I’m afraid that we will lose a team that has its own style. Perhaps Zabolotny will move to Kazan and we will see Khimki-2 in action,” Mor said on the air of the “Everyone for the Match!” program. on Match TV.
After 18 rounds, Rubin ranks seventh in the WORLD RPL with 23 points. The Kazan team has been headed by Rashid Rakhimov since 2023.
